Florence, AL – Centiva’s, Stria was requested by DIY Network’s I Hate My Bath and is being featured in upcoming episodes.

Host Jeff Devlin will help a couple to put style and function back into the space by using the natural architecture of the room to create a better layout. The addition of double vanities, innovative storage ideas, and an interesting Centiva floor cut into a herringbone pattern helped to create a historic style with modern luxury. Stria is a luxury vinyl tile product out of the Centiva Victory Series. It is manufactured in the USA and contains over 50% recycled content.
